Artificial intelligence is no longer a futuristic concept—it’s a practical tool that can help businesses improve efficiency, streamline processes, and save time. Many companies hesitate to adopt AI because they fear a complete workflow overhaul. The good news is that AI can be integrated gradually and effectively without disrupting your existing operations.
- Identify Repetitive Tasks
Start by looking at the tasks your team performs daily that are time-consuming or repetitive. Common examples include:
- Drafting emails or responses
- Scheduling meetings
- Organizing and updating spreadsheets
- Generating reports
By applying AI to these tasks, your team can focus on higher-value work that requires critical thinking and creativity.
- Start Small
Implement AI in one department or for a specific task first. This allows your team to test the tool, learn best practices, and gradually expand its use. Starting small reduces risk and builds confidence across the organization.
- Train Your Team
Even the best AI tools are only effective if your team knows how to use them properly. Provide training sessions, tutorials, or step-by-step guides so employees feel comfortable incorporating AI into their daily routines. Encourage experimentation and sharing of tips to maximize adoption.
- Integrate with Existing Workflows
AI doesn’t need to replace the tools your team already uses. Many AI solutions integrate seamlessly with platforms like Microsoft 365, Teams, OneDrive, and popular CRM systems. Focus on enhancing existing processes rather than starting from scratch.
- Monitor and Adjust
Regularly track the impact of AI on productivity, efficiency, and overall team performance. Collect feedback from employees and make adjustments as needed. Optimization is key to ensuring AI continues to add value over time.
- Maintain Security and Compliance
When introducing AI, be mindful of data security and regulatory compliance. Ensure sensitive information is protected, and your AI tools comply with industry standards and internal policies. This step is crucial for maintaining trust with clients and employees.
- Balance Automation and Human Insight
AI can handle many administrative or analytical tasks, but human judgment remains essential. Use AI to support decision-making, not replace it. The combination of human expertise and AI efficiency creates the most productive outcomes.
Adopting AI doesn’t mean overhauling your business. By starting small, training your team, integrating with existing tools, and monitoring performance, AI can boost productivity without disrupting your workflows.
